Off she goes in the North 4/4L · J32

1–
: 1c cast off one and cross RH, cast off one and cross LH and cast off to 4pl
9–
: 1c cast up one and cross LH, cast up one and cross RH and cast up to 1pl
17–
: 1c+2c & 3c+4c cross, the W passing NHJ under arches made by the M ; they all cross back, the W again pass under the arches
25–
: 1c+2c+3c+4c Poussette, 1c moving to the bottom, 2c+3c+4c one place up.
Off she goes in the North 4/4L · J32

1-8
: 1s cast 1 place, cross RH, cast down 1 place, cross LH & cast to 4th
  place
9-16
: 1s cast up retracing above Fig back to places
17-24
: 1s+2s also 3s+4s cross (Ladies under Men's arches) & repeat back to
  places
25-32
: 1s+2s+3s+4s dance Poussette (1s to 4th place by dancing out to Men's
  side **while** other cpls dance out to Ladies side 1 place up)
